1 General Information Africa-India Mobility Fund (AIMF) The AIMF will fund researchers from India and Africa for short visits in either direction to explore opportunities for building and strengthening scientific collaborations These are expected to enhance skills and contribute to the growth of knowledge and leadership towards common health challenges Researchers working in India or Africa can apply for travel and subsistence funding over a 3-month period at a university, medical school or research institution in one of the partner countries Vision To establish links and cultivate a culture of collaboration between African and Indian researchers that will serve as a vehicle to improve research capacity and build leadership in biomedical and clinical research for Africa and India Overall Goal: The AIMF is intended to fund researchers from Africa and India for short visits in either direction to explore opportunities for building and strengthening scientific collaborations These are expected to enhance skills and contribute to the growth of knowledge and leadership towards common health challenges Collaborations should focus on a single project involving researchers in Africa and India, respectively Objectives To strengthen research & innovation capacity and knowledge exchange To strengthen scientific collaboration in India and Africa Eligibility of Applicants 1 Nationals of India and nationals of countries comprising the African continent 2 Based either in India or in Africa, and be affiliated with a recognized academic, medical, research or other similar institutions Those based at for-profit organizations are not eligible 3 Possess a PhD/MD or equivalent research qualification Applicants within 15 years of PhD/MD would be preferred 4 Hold a permanent or fixed-term contract in an eligible institution, which must span the duration of the visit 5 Individuals are eligible to receive only one grant per year Science The scientific scope of applicants responsive to this funding should be broadly focused on infectious and non-communicable diseases of relevance to local, national, or global health The scope of the collaborative opportunity may include but is not limited to HIV/AIDS, TB, dengue, malaria, vector-borne diseases, parasitic infections, emerging infections, cancer, 1 diabetes, hypertension, health systems research, AMR, drug development, microbiome and general biomedical sciences 2 While applications that involve existing collaborations will be considered, applications that target new collaborations are particularly encouraged For full details on the funding opportunity announcement, please visit the AAS website at: http://aasciencesacke/aesa/en/programmes Page 3 of 11
